tools/spec: remove unused enqueue_type function

This commit is contained in:
Danny Robson 2019-01-05 12:00:31 +11:00
parent 05867df536
commit 44edf5d00e

View File

@ -880,26 +880,8 @@ def write_dispatch(path:str, q):
###############################################################################
def enqueue_type(name:str, queued:Set[str], types:Dict[str,type]):
if name in queued:
return []
result = []
obj = types[name]
for d in obj.depends:
if d == name:
continue
result += enqueue_type(name=d, queued=queued, types=types)
assert name not in queued
queued.add(name)
result += [obj]
return result
import argparse